At 8:23 PM +0100 6/21/00, Kevin Miller wrote:

>I think perhaps you're a little confused about the exact meaning of
>"keyDown" and "keyUp".  Keydown is sent when a key is pressed, keyUp is sent
>after the character has been drawn into the field.  KeyUp doesn't indicate
>that the key is *up* - it could still be down, in which case another keyDown
>and another keyUp message will be sent.
>
>Because no field is active in your case, no keyUp message will ever be sent.

It seems to work differently on Windows (on NT anyway). KeyUps and 
rawKeyUps get sent even without an active field. A series rawKeyUps 
and rawKeyDowns get sent when the key is depressed for a long time, 
matching the normal key repeat rate. This happens on cards with no 
controls of any kind. All keys seem to get detected, including the 
shift key. Is this a Mac limitation or perhaps a bug in the Mac 
engine?
